Josh Ruffels

Josh Ruffels

Shrewsbury TownShrewsbury Town

178

Height (cm)

75

Weight (kg)

25

Number

32

Age

Left

Foot

-

Value

EnglandEngland
LBLeft-Back

About Josh Ruffels

Josh Ruffels is a 32-year-old England professional football left-back. Currently playing for Shrewsbury Town wearing the number 25 shirt. Standing 1m 78cm tall. Preferred foot: left.

This season in FA Cup, Josh Ruffels has made 2 appearances. Average match rating: 6.92.

Career statistics show 27 total goals and 21 assists across 355 appearances in 43 seasons. Has won 2 trophies throughout career.

View Josh Ruffels's complete scoring rankings, compare with other players, and follow live match updates on Soccer Offices.

Current Season

FA CupFA Cup

2

Matches

0

Goals

0

Assists

160

Minutes

6.92

Rating

1

Yellow

0

Red

League TwoLeague Two

10

Matches

1

Goals

0

Assists

765

Minutes

6.87

Rating

1

Yellow

0

Red

355

Matches

27

Goals

21

Assists

SeasonMGAMin
Shrewsbury Town

2025/2026

FA Cup
2--1601-
Shrewsbury Town

2025/2026

League Two
101-7651-
Huddersfield Town

2024/2025

FA Cup
------
Huddersfield Town

2024/2025

Carabao Cup
11-901-
Huddersfield Town

2024/2025

League One
22--14223-
2--105--
Huddersfield Town

2023/2024

Carabao Cup
------
Huddersfield Town

2023/2024

Championship
11--7801-
1--90--
Huddersfield Town

2022/2023

FA Cup
------
Huddersfield Town

2022/2023

Carabao Cup
------
Huddersfield Town

2022/2023

Championship
333-2576--
2--90--
1-----
Huddersfield Town

2021/2022

FA Cup
3--235--
Huddersfield Town

2021/2022

Carabao Cup
------
Huddersfield Town

2021/2022

Championship
8--175--
Oxford United

2020/2021

League One
446638641-
Oxford United

2020/2021

FA Cup
11-90--
Oxford United

2020/2021

Carabao Cup
1--120--
Oxford United

2019/2020

FA Cup
4-1390--
Oxford United

2019/2020

Carabao Cup
4--390--
Oxford United

2019/2020

League One
383434022-
Oxford United

2018/2019

FA Cup
3-1270--
Oxford United

2018/2019

League One
444136995-
Oxford United

2018/2019

Carabao Cup
2--110--
Oxford United

2017/2018

FA Cup
1--63--
Oxford United

2017/2018

League One
385429311-
Oxford United

2017/2018

Carabao Cup
1-11201-
Oxford United

2015/2016

Carabao Cup
1-----
Oxford United

2014/2015

Carabao Cup
2-----
Oxford United

2013/2014

Carabao Cup
------
Oxford United

2015/2016

FA Cup
------
Oxford United

2014/2015

FA Cup
1-----
Oxford United

2013/2014

FA Cup
2-----
Oxford United

2016/2017

FA Cup
311219--
Oxford United

2016/2017

Carabao Cup
1--90--
Oxford United

2013/2014

League Two
2--90--
Oxford United

2015/2016

League Two
12-----
Oxford United

2014/2015

League Two
33--26101-
Oxford United

2016/2017

League One
202213403-
Coventry City

2011/2012

Championship
1--72--
Coventry City

2010/2011

Championship
------

About Josh Ruffels

Josh Ruffels currently plays for Shrewsbury Town.
Josh Ruffels plays as a Defender.
Josh Ruffels is from England.
Josh Ruffels is 32 years old (born 23 October 1993).
Josh Ruffels is 178 cm tall and weighs 75 kg.
Josh Ruffels has scored 27 goals and provided 21 assists in 355 career appearances.
Josh Ruffels wears the number 25 jersey for Shrewsbury Town.